Form 4: G-III Apparel Group Director Receives RSUs
Insider Transaction Report
Victor Herrero, a Director at G-III Apparel Group, Ltd., has been granted 3,644 restricted stock units (RSUs) that vest on June 11, 2027.
Summary
- Victor Herrero, a Director at G-III Apparel Group, Ltd., received 3,644 restricted stock units (RSUs) on June 11, 2026.
- These RSUs represent a contingent right to receive one share of common stock each.
- The RSUs are subject to a cliff vesting schedule, with full vesting occurring on June 11, 2027, provided Herrero remains a Director with G-III through that date.
- Following this transaction, Herrero beneficially owns 58,390 shares of common stock.
